What is inbound marketing?

In complicated terms, inbound marketing is a strategy that creates valuable content aligning with your customer’s needs. In simple terms, inbound marketing enables brand awareness and engages the audience.

Inbound marketing strategy does what your teachers did in your school (at least we hope they did ;p) – providing solutions to your problems. Catering to your client’s issues is imperative to maintain your brand identity.

Why choose inbound marketing?

As you have figured, inbound digital marketing aims to sustain your business’s brand image. In return, we have figured out your next question – why is it better than traditional marketing techniques?

Traditional marketing techniques are better known as outbound marketing techniques. In this context, they include advertisements through TV and radio commercials, print ads in newspapers and magazines, along with email blasts and cold calling.

Do you remember the days before you successfully blocked all these advertisements? While outbound marketing is generally effective in grabbing customers’ attention, it is slowly losing its purpose. We have entered an age wherein even the slightest inconveniences unmotivated us.

You can see that the goals of either strategy are the same. They both focus on sales, engagement, lead generation, and brand awareness. However, an inbound strategy is better suited because it doesn’t annoy your customers. Oh, and it is cheaper.

Let’s list down solutions that inbound marketing strategy provides you with:

  1. Website traffic: Using digital tools like SEO, generating higher traffic to your business website is effortless. It also boosts lead generation.
  2. Credibility: With increasing businesses, you cannot doubt that a customer won’t be skeptical of your pop-ups. With a careful approach, inbound digital marketing gives them content that is rich in value, which makes it easier for them to trust you.
  3. Marketing Budget: Once you have a good investment, you can imagine spending money to engage in outbound marketing. However, long-lasting web content makes much more sense if you have a limited budget dedicated to marketing.
  4. Sales: You already know that the primary purpose of inbound digital marketing is to solve customers’ problems. When you engage in providing answers, your chances of increasing sales increase ten-fold.
  5. Sustainability: This is formed through brand awareness and consistency. Once you start catering to consumer demand, your brand is securing its long-run seat in consumers’ hearts.
